West Virginia Code § 22-9-12

Penalties

Any person who shall willfully violate any order of the director issued pursuant to the
provisions of this article shall be guilty of a misdemeanor, and, on conviction thereof, shall
be punished by a fine not exceeding $2,000, or imprisoned in jail for not exceeding twelve
months, or both, in the discretion of the court, and prosecutions under this section may be
brought in the name of the State of West Virginia in the court exercising crieminal jurisdiction
in the county in which the violation of such provisions of the article or terms of such order
was committed, and at the instance and upon the relation of any citizenr of this state.
